Sharm El Sheikh is basically divided into three main regions: Sharm el Maya, where the airport is based as well as many private yachts and pleasure boats that take divers to the best diving spots in the area like Ras Mohammed. Ras Om El Seed, famous for its coral reefs, has a very high cliff where many hotels are situated.

As you might expect in such a prime diving location, there is a large selection of private companies offering diving courses at all levels and it is one of the cheapest places in the world to pick up a PADI (Professional Association of Diving Instructors) qualification.

It is surrounded by three protected areas:

• Ras Mohammed Natural Protected Park.
• St. Katherine National Park.
• Nabq Protected Area.
